
//#################################################################
// Sehbereich ausmessen

function Fensterhoehe() {
	    var myHeight = 0;
	 
	    if( typeof( window.innerWidth ) == 'number' ) {
	        //Non-IE
	        //myWidth = window.innerWidth;
	        myHeight = window.innerHeight;
	    } 
	    else if( document.documentElement && ( document.documentElement.clientWidth || document.documentElement.clientHeight ) ) {
	        //IE 6+ in 'standards compliant mode'
	        //myWidth = document.documentElement.clientWidth;
	        myHeight = document.documentElement.clientHeight;
	    } 
	    else if( document.body && ( document.body.clientWidth || document.body.clientHeight ) ) {
	        //IE 4 compatible
	        //myWidth = document.body.clientWidth;
	        myHeight = document.body.clientHeight;
	    }
	    return myHeight;
}





//#################################################################



function main_resizer(){
	
	var f_hoehe = Fensterhoehe();
	var gesammt_h = document.getElementById("menu_wrapper").offsetHeight + document.getElementById("content").offsetHeight + document.getElementById("footer").offsetHeight;

	var gesammt_margin = 120;
	
	
	gesammt_h = gesammt_h + gesammt_margin;
	
	if (gesammt_h < f_hoehe){
		h = f_hoehe - document.getElementById("menu_wrapper").offsetHeight - document.getElementById("content").offsetHeight - document.getElementById("footer").offsetHeight - gesammt_margin;
		document.getElementById("distance").style.height = h + "px";
	}
	else{
		document.getElementById("distance").style.height = "100px";
	}
		
	
}











/* Überwachung von Netscape initialisieren */
if (!window.Weite && window.innerWidth) {
  window.onresize = main_resizer;
}

